To some Spanish primary students in bilingual schools, content and language integrated learning (CLIL) textbooks may include specific and unknown new concepts or information that they must learn. Is the concept the same in the mother tongue, and is the language used to express it similar? To facilitate learning, teachers, through a didactic transposition process and particular teaching techniques, disclose the essential information that bilingual pupils need to know. Recognize examples of these phrases and learn … Traditional grammar classifies words based on eight parts of speech: the verb, the noun, the pronoun, the adjective, the adverb, the preposition, the conjunction, and the interjection.. Each part of speech explains not what the word is, but how the word is used.In fact, the same word can be a noun in one sentence and a verb or adjective in the next. Unfortunately, in translations to Spanish of concept mapping documents, proposition has been often translated to preposition and there is now a widespread misconception in the Spanish-speaking part of the world that concept maps consist of concepts linked together by prepositions.
